After the devastating flood disaster in July 2021, the municipalities faced a once-in-a-century challenge of reconstruction. Commissioned by several public sector clients, Julius Berger International has since supported reconstruction efforts with a holistic, interdisciplinary project management approach – structured, efficient, and transparent.

Multi-Project Management

Reconstruction in the Ahr Valley comprises around 1, work packages, totaling over €3 billion. The scope ranges from measures to address destroyed infrastructure such as roads, bridges, administrative buildings, and schools to highly complex new planning for flood protection, sustainable energy supply, and digital infrastructure.

Across several of the affected municipalities, Julius Berger International has been tasked with total responsibility for project steering. As the central contact point for authorities, planning offices, contractors, and funding bodies, the company coordinates all processes – from the initial damage assessment to operative implementation support.

Services at a Glance

Damage Assessment & Evaluation

  • Systematic recording of affected structures
  • Technical classification by scope and urgency of damage
  • Prioritization of measures based on needs or political decisions
  •  Clarification of ownership and responsibilities

Project Initiation & Preparation

  • Definition of project type, scope, and preliminary cost estimates
  • Setting schedules, milestones, and timeframes
  • Tendering for planners, engineers, and experts
  • Initial consultations with funding bodies and permits
  • Development of databases and standardized cost catalogues

Cost Estimation & Financing

  • Refinement of cost calculations based on updated data
  • Cross-trade quantity take-offs for materials and services
  • Development of reliable pricing databases
  • Creation of financing and funding strategies
  • Application, controlling, and timely reporting obligations

Project Execution (Single Projects)

  • Detailed planning and coordination of implementation steps
  • Awarding of contracts and ongoing budget control
  • Scheduling, plan verification, and plausibility checks
  • Verification, approval, and processing of invoices

Multi-Project Management (Overall Steering)

  • Identification, prioritization, and steering of all projects
  • Coordination of interfaces between projects and stakeholders
  • Overarching cost, schedule, and risk management
  • Ensuring quality standards, processes, and documentation
  • Regular reporting and transparent communication
